@@ -1026,6 +1028,295 @@ SWITCH_DECLARE(switch_status_t) switch_ivr_record_session(switch_core_session_t
        return SWITCH_STATUS_SUCCESS;
 }
 
+typedef struct  {
+       SpeexPreprocessState *read_st;
+       SpeexPreprocessState *write_st;
+       SpeexEchoState *read_ec;
+       SpeexEchoState *write_ec;
+       switch_byte_t read_data[2048];
+       switch_byte_t write_data[2048];
+       switch_byte_t read_out[2048];
+       switch_byte_t write_out[2048];
+       switch_mutex_t *read_mutex;
+       switch_mutex_t *write_mutex;
+       int done;
+} pp_cb_t;
+
+static switch_bool_t preprocess_callback(switch_media_bug_t *bug, void *user_data, switch_abc_type_t type)
+{
+       switch_core_session_t *session = switch_core_media_bug_get_session(bug);
+       switch_channel_t *channel = switch_core_session_get_channel(session);
+       pp_cb_t *cb = (pp_cb_t *) user_data;
+       switch_codec_implementation_t read_impl = {0};
+
+    switch_core_session_get_read_impl(session, &read_impl);
+       switch_frame_t *frame = NULL;
+       int y;
+       
+       switch (type) {
+       case SWITCH_ABC_TYPE_INIT:
+               {
+                       switch_mutex_init(&cb->read_mutex, SWITCH_MUTEX_NESTED, switch_core_session_get_pool(session));
+                       switch_mutex_init(&cb->write_mutex, SWITCH_MUTEX_NESTED, switch_core_session_get_pool(session));
+               }
+               break;
+       case SWITCH_ABC_TYPE_CLOSE:
+               {
+                       if (cb->read_st) {
+                               speex_preprocess_state_destroy(cb->read_st);
+                       }
+
+                       if (cb->write_st) {
+                               speex_preprocess_state_destroy(cb->write_st);
+                       }
+
+                       if (cb->read_ec) {
+                               speex_echo_state_destroy(cb->read_ec);
+                       }
+
+                       if (cb->write_ec) {
+                               speex_echo_state_destroy(cb->write_ec);
+                       }
+
+                       switch_channel_set_private(channel, "_preprocess", NULL);
+               }
+               break;
+       case SWITCH_ABC_TYPE_READ_REPLACE:
+               {
+                       if (cb->done) return SWITCH_FALSE;
+                       frame = switch_core_media_bug_get_read_replace_frame(bug);
+
+                       if (cb->read_st) {
+
+                               if (cb->read_ec) {
+                                       speex_echo_cancellation(cb->read_ec, (int16_t *)frame->data, (int16_t *)cb->write_data, (int16_t *)cb->read_out);
+                                       memcpy(frame->data, cb->read_out, frame->datalen);
+                               }
+
+                               y = speex_preprocess_run(cb->read_st, frame->data);                             
+                       }
+
+                       if (cb->write_ec) {
+                               memcpy(cb->read_data, frame->data, frame->datalen);
+                       }
+               }
+               break;
+       case SWITCH_ABC_TYPE_WRITE_REPLACE:
+               {
+                       if (cb->done) return SWITCH_FALSE;
+                       frame = switch_core_media_bug_get_write_replace_frame(bug);
+
+                       if (cb->write_st) {
+
+                               if (cb->write_ec) {
+                                       speex_echo_cancellation(cb->write_ec, (int16_t *)frame->data, (int16_t *)cb->read_data, (int16_t *)cb->write_out);
+                                       memcpy(frame->data, cb->write_out, frame->datalen);
+                               }
+                               
+                               y = speex_preprocess_run(cb->write_st, frame->data);
+                       }
+
+                       if (cb->read_ec) {
+                               memcpy(cb->write_data, frame->data, frame->datalen);
+                       }
+               }
+               break;
+       default:
+               break;
+       }
+
+       return SWITCH_TRUE;
+}
+
+SWITCH_DECLARE(switch_status_t) switch_ivr_preprocess_session(switch_core_session_t *session, const char *cmds)
+{
+       switch_channel_t *channel = switch_core_session_get_channel(session);
+       switch_media_bug_t *bug;
+       switch_status_t status;
+       time_t to = 0;
+       switch_media_bug_flag_t flags = 0;
+       switch_codec_implementation_t read_impl = {0};
+       pp_cb_t *cb;
+       int update = 0;
+       int argc;
+       char *mydata = NULL, *argv[5];
+       int i = 0;
+
+    switch_core_session_get_read_impl(session, &read_impl);
+
+       if ((cb = switch_channel_get_private(channel, "_preprocess"))) {
+               update = 1;
+       } else {
+               cb = switch_core_session_alloc(session, sizeof(*cb));           
+       }
+
+
+       if (update) {
+               if (!strcasecmp(cmds, "stop")) {
+                       cb->done = 1;
+                       return SWITCH_STATUS_SUCCESS;
+               }
+       }
+
+       mydata = strdup(cmds);
+       argc = switch_separate_string(mydata, ',', argv, (sizeof(argv) / sizeof(argv[0])));
+       
+       for(i = 0; i < argc; i++) {
+               char *var = argv[i];
+               char *val = NULL;
+               char rw;
+               int tr;
+               int err = 1;
+               SpeexPreprocessState *st = NULL;
+               SpeexEchoState *ec;
+               switch_mutex_t *mutex = NULL;
+               int r = 0;
+
+               if (var) {
+                       if ((val = strchr(var, '='))) {
+                               *val++ = '\0';
+                               
+                               rw = *var++;
+                               while(*var == '.' || *var == '_') {
+                                       var++;
+                               }
+                               
+                               if (rw == 'r') {
+                                       if (!cb->read_st) {
+                                               cb->read_st = speex_preprocess_state_init(read_impl.samples_per_packet, read_impl.samples_per_second);
+                                               flags |= SMBF_READ_REPLACE;
+                                       }
+                                       st = cb->read_st;
+                                       ec = cb->read_ec;
+                                       mutex = cb->read_mutex;
+                               } else if (rw == 'w') {
+                                       if (!cb->write_st) {
+                                               cb->write_st = speex_preprocess_state_init(read_impl.samples_per_packet, read_impl.samples_per_second);
+                                               flags |= SMBF_WRITE_REPLACE;
+                                       }
+                                       st = cb->write_st;
+                                       ec = cb->write_ec;
+                                       mutex = cb->write_mutex;
+                               }
+
+                               if (mutex) switch_mutex_lock(mutex);
+                               
+                               if (st) {
+                                       err = 0;
+                                       tr = switch_true(val);
+                                       if (!strcasecmp(var, "agc")) {
+                                               int l = read_impl.samples_per_second;
+                                               int tmp = atoi(val);
+
+                                               if (!tr) {
+                                                       l = tmp;
+                                               }
+
+                                               swit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_DEBUG, "Setting AGC on %c to %d\n", rw, tr);
+                                               speex_preprocess_ctl(st, SPEEX_PREPROCESS_SET_AGC, &tr);
+                                               speex_preprocess_ctl(st, SPEEX_PREPROCESS_SET_AGC_LEVEL, &l);
+
+                                       } else if (!strcasecmp(var, "noise_supress")) {
+                                               int db = atoi(val);
+                                               if (db < 0) {
+                                                       r = speex_preprocess_ctl(st, SPEEX_PREPROCESS_SET_NOISE_SUPPRESS, &db);
+                                                       swit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_DEBUG, "Setting NOISE_SUPRESS on %c to %d [%d]\n", rw, db, r);
+                                               } else {
+                                                       swit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_ERROR, "Syntax error noise_supress should be in -db\n");
+                                               }
+                                       } else if (!strcasecmp(var, "echo_cancel")) {
+                                               int tail = 1024;
+                                               int tmp = atoi(val);
+
+                                               if (!tr && tmp > 0) {
+                                                       tail = tmp;
+                                               } else if (!tr) {
+                                                       if (ec) {
+                                                               if (rw == 'r') {
+                                                                       speex_echo_state_destroy(cb->read_ec);
+                                                                       cb->read_ec = NULL;
+                                                               } else {
+                                                                       speex_echo_state_destroy(cb->write_ec);
+                                                                       cb->write_ec = NULL;
+                                                               }
+                                                       }
+                                                       
+                                                       ec = NULL;
+                                               }
+                                               
+                                               if (!ec) {
+                                                       if (rw == 'r') {
+                                                               ec = cb->read_ec = speex_echo_state_init(read_impl.samples_per_packet, tail);
+                                                               speex_echo_ctl(ec, SPEEX_ECHO_SET_SAMPLING_RATE, &read_impl.samples_per_second);
+                                                               flags |= SMBF_WRITE_REPLACE;
+                                                       } else {
+                                                               ec = cb->write_ec = speex_echo_state_init(read_impl.samples_per_packet, tail);
+                                                               speex_echo_ctl(ec, SPEEX_ECHO_SET_SAMPLING_RATE, &read_impl.samples_per_second);
+                                                               flags |= SMBF_READ_REPLACE;
+                                                       }
+                                                       speex_preprocess_ctl(st, SPEEX_PREPROCESS_SET_ECHO_STATE, ec);
+                                               }
+
+
+                                       } else if (!strcasecmp(var, "echo_supress")) {
+                                               int db = atoi(val);
+                                               if (db < 0) {
+                                                       speex_preprocess_ctl(st, SPEEX_PREPROCESS_SET_ECHO_SUPPRESS, &db);
+                                                       swit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_DEBUG, "Setting ECHO_SUPRESS on %c to %d [%d]\n", rw, db, r);
+                                               } else {
+                                                       swit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_ERROR, "Syntax error echo_supress should be in -db\n");
+                                               }
+                                       } else {
+                                               swit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_WARNING, "Warning unknown parameter [%s] \n", var);
+                                       }
+                               }
+                       }
+
+                       if (mutex) switch_mutex_unlock(mutex);
+
+                       if (err) {
+                               swit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_ERROR, "Syntax error parsing preprossor commands\n");
+                       }
+
+               } else {
+                       break;
+               }
+       }
+
+
+       switch_safe_free(mydata);
+
+       if (update) {
+               return SWITCH_STATUS_SUCCESS;
+       }
+
+
+       if ((status = switch_core_media_bug_add(session, preprocess_callback, cb, to, flags, &bug)) != SWITCH_STATUS_SUCCESS) {
+               switch_log_printf(SWITCH_CHANNEL_SESSION_LOG(session), SWITCH_LOG_ERROR, "Error adding media bug.\n");
+               if (cb->read_st) {
+                       speex_preprocess_state_destroy(cb->read_st);
+               }
+               
+               if (cb->write_st) {
+                       speex_preprocess_state_destroy(cb->write_st);
+               }
+
+               if (cb->read_ec) {
+                       speex_echo_state_destroy(cb->read_ec);
+               }
+               
+               if (cb->write_ec) {
+                       speex_echo_state_destroy(cb->write_ec);
+               }
+               
+               return status;
+       }
+
+       switch_channel_set_private(channel, "_preprocess", cb);
+
+       return SWITCH_STATUS_SUCCESS;
+}
